Sunday, December 25, 2011

Blues Trees, A Lady and her Stockings, and The Salon Gallery

I’m proud to report that the holidays have not slowed down our artistic pursuits. We met two other times besides the one I’m posting now, but it was mainly prep work for the other pieces we’d been working on and therefore not much for us to document.

However, this last time Erin started a new tree piece. She spent the majority of her time layering on the background colors in a circular motion.

The pictures don’t accurately capture the earth tones of the piece, as the first is too green and the second too orange.



Erin recently added more trees.







I was inspired to paint a rendition of a photograph by Jeff Dunas.


I started by focusing on the dark aspects of the photograph. Parts of the picture are heavily shadowed and so instead of applying black or brown, I added a dark green to the black which changed the overall tone of the piece.










I am going to practice more drawing this week, but I believe sketching earlier helped me feel able to jump right in and paint her body (and the prodding from Erin didn’t hurt either).










Also, we put some pieces up for sale in our sister's salon, Twistyle Salon and Day Spa located at 1332 Bethel Road, Columbus, OH.














It's the first time we've exhibited our work like this, and we are excited to be taking this next step.





Here's to new year full of artful endeavors!









Sunday, December 4, 2011

A Tranquil Piece, The Perfect Match, and Mr. Smug...

Our latest art adventure…

The following are a compilation of two art sessions. Erin decided to create a piece for her massage room. She started with some textured paper, a few pieces of jewelry, and went from there. 





She plans to hang them in a series.







Here are some close-ups to show the amazing detail in the branches and flowers.








She has yet to name the piece, but it will be displayed in her room soon!


I’m working on a piece for my friend, Krista. It began as a joke about relationships and our influence from movies, advertisements and other such media for that perfect match.




Erin and I have been experimenting with paint on black and white photographs, and so I was inspired to copy these ads from beauty magazines, convert them into photographs, and am now compiling them on drywall.








I’m hoping the end result will be a mix between pop art and scrapbooking.
